Newport Pagnell is a historical market town with roots dating back to the Iron Age and the Roman period. Home to Aston Martin, this thriving town offers a bustling high street with a variety of shops including Boots, the Co-op, local butchers, bakers, and greengrocers. Dining options abound with numerous restaurants and pubs to choose from. For leisure activities, residents can make use of the local indoor swimming pool and public library.

The town is conveniently located close to Milton Keynes, providing easy access to shopping and theatre experiences. With the M1 motorway nearby, commuting to London or the north is a breeze. Plus, excellent rail links make travelling to London in just 45 minutes a reality.

In terms of education, Newport Pagnell boasts a selection of well-regarded schools including Cedars School, Green Park School, Ousedale School, Portfields School, and Tickford Park School.
